 In order to spot whether a device (e.g. root) might get filled up soonish it might be helpful to optionally show "progressbars" (maybe also the gtk-widget, not sure what'd work best here) to symbolize that.\\ In order to spot whether a device (e.g. root) might get filled up soonish it might be helpful to optionally show "progressbars" (maybe also the gtk-widget, not sure what'd work best here) to symbolize that.\\
 The mockup below should point out how this could theoretically look.
